溫馨提示×

Debian dhcp與DNS集成步驟

小樊
58
2025-03-14 21:13:57
欄目: 智能運維

在Debian系統中將DHCP與DNS集成,通常意味著配置DHCP服務器以動態更新DNS記錄,或者配置DNS服務器以響應DHCP請求。以下是詳細步驟:

安裝DHCP服務器和DNS服務器

  1. 安裝ISC DHCP服務器
sudo apt-get update
sudo apt-get install isc-dhcp-server
  1. 安裝BIND DNS服務器
sudo apt-get install bind9 bind9utils

配置DHCP服務器

  1. 編輯DHCP配置文件
sudo nano /etc/dhcp/dhcpd.conf
  1. 配置靜態或動態IP地址分配
  • 靜態IP:為特定MAC地址分配固定IP。
  • 動態IP:配置地址池供DHCP動態分配。
  1. 配置DNS服務器信息

在配置文件中添加以下行,以設置DHCP服務器提供的DNS服務器地址:

option domain-name-servers 8.8.8.8;
  1. 重啟DHCP服務
sudo systemctl restart isc-dhcp-server

配置DNS服務器

  1. 編輯BIND配置文件
sudo nano /etc/bind/named.conf.options
  1. 添加轉發器

如果希望DNS服務器轉發請求到上游DNS服務器,可以添加如下配置:

forwarders {
    8.8.8.8;
    8.8.4.4;
};
  1. 重啟BIND服務
sudo systemctl restart bind9

驗證配置

  1. 檢查DHCP分配的DNS信息

通過DHCP客戶端獲取的IP地址,可以使用以下命令查看DNS服務器信息:

cat /var/lib/dhcp/dhclient.leases
  1. 檢查DNS解析

使用nslookupdig命令測試DNS解析是否正常工作。

nslookup example.com

以上步驟概述了在Debian系統中配置DHCP服務器以動態更新DNS記錄的基本流程。根據具體需求,可能還需要進一步調整配置。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女